steamed mochi rice with toppings
A traditional Japanese dish of glutinous rice steamed with fish or other ingredients on top. Often associated with regional cuisine.
郷土料理の飯蒸しは、もち米と魚を一緒に蒸して作ります。
The local dish iimushi is made by steaming glutinous rice and fish together.

Compound of 飯 (ii, 'cooked rice', archaic reading) + 蒸し (mushi, 'steaming'). The exact historical origin is uncertain, but the name directly describes the cooking method.
